About this album

Professor Vishnu Govind Jod, who plays the violin in the North Indian style, had his initial training from his cousin Shankarrao Athavale and the late Ganpat Rao Purohit. Later he has his training from Vighneswara Shastri and he completed his learning from Srikrishna Narayan Ratanjankar, a great musicologist and musician.

He also had the opportunity to receive valuable guidance from Ustad Allauddin Khan.

An artiste with immense charm and gentle manners, he is not only marked for his solo performances but also as an accompanist, and has accompanied such all time greats as Faiyaz Khan, Omkarnath Thakur, Bade Ghulam Ali Khan, Kesarbai Kerkar and Hirabai Barodekar.

He came into prominence as a violinist in the early fifties, and later joined the staff of All India Radio. He left the Radio in 1972 and is now devoted entirely to the cause of music teaching and propagation.
